How to Make Chicken Buffalo Dip

Ingredients:

  • 3 frozen chicken breasts
  • 8 oz cream cheese
  • 1 cup ranch dressing
  • 1 cup Frank’s RedHot sauce (or preferred hot sauce)
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ese

Directions:

  1. In a large pan, cover the frozen chicken breasts with water and boil on high until fully cooked (about 20 minutes).
  2. In the crock pot (or large bowl), stir together the cream cheese, ranch dressing, hot sauce, and cheddar cheese.
  3. Shred the cooked chicken and fold it into the mixture.
  4. Set the crock pot to low and heat for about 30 minutes, until the dip is bubbly and well-combined.

How to Serve Chicken Buffalo Dip

Serve Chicken Buffalo Dip warm with tortilla chips, crackers, or celery sticks. It’s great for dipping, and guests will love the spicy, cheesy flavor. You can also serve it in small bowls for individual portions.

How to Store Chicken Buffalo Dip

To store leftover Chicken Buffalo Dip, let it cool completely. Transfer it to an airtight container and place it in the refrigerator. It will stay fresh for about 3–4 days. If you want to reheat it, just warm it up in the microwave or the crock pot.

Tips to Make Chicken Buffalo Dip

  • If you prefer a spicier dip, add more hot sauce to suit your taste.
  • Make sure to shred the chicken finely for better mixing.
  • You can use cooked chicken from a rotisserie chicken if you’re short on time.

Variation

For a healthier version, you can substitute the cream cheese with Greek yogurt. You can also use low-fat ranch dressing and reduced-fat cheese to lighten it up.

FAQs

1. Can I use fresh chicken instead of frozen?
Yes, you can use fresh chicken breasts. Just adjust the cooking time accordingly.

2. Can I make this dip 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the ingredients and store them in the fridge. Just combine and heat when you are ready to serve.

3. Is this dip spicy?
The spiciness depends on the hot sauce you use. Frank’s RedHot sauce has a moderate heat level, but you can adjust it to your preference.
